Energy research at UNL’s COE spans a wide range of activities from the development of innovative materials constructed at the atomistic level, to renewable energy generation, to simulation of the electrical transmission in power grid.
College of Engineering activities address the NAE Grand Challenge of Making Solar Energy Economical.
